Blok Zinciri #7 - Çatallaşma (Fork)

#10・
19

sayıs

Listeme abone olun

By subscribing, you agree with Revue’s Kullanım Koşulları and Gizlilik Sözleşmesi and understand that Hakan'ın Blockchain & Bitcoin & Altcoin Yazıları will receive your email address.

Hakan'ın Blockchain & Bitcoin & Altcoin Yazıları
Hakan'ın Blockchain & Bitcoin & Altcoin Yazıları
Blok Zinciri(Blockchain) Teknolojisine Giriş- 7
Bir önceki yazıda “Akıllı Sözleşmeler"den bahsetmiştik. Bugün ise kripto-para yatırımcılarının oldukça aşina olduğu çatallaşma konusuna değineceğim.
Çatallaşma (Fork) Nedir?
En basit cevabı; bütün blok zincirleri birer yazılımdır (dolayısıyla bütün kripto-paralar), çatallaşma ise bu yazılımlarda yapılan değişikliklerdir.
Bitcoin gibi bir varlığa sahip olduğunuzda, gerçekten sahip olduğunuz şey yalnızca çoğunlukla public ve private olarak adlandırılan bir çift anahtardır. Bu anahtarlar, kimin ve neye ait olduğunu takip eden ağa erişme yeteneğini temsil eder.
Bu yazılım değiştirildiğinde, kullanıcının kendi varlığı üzerindeki hakları önemli ölçüde değiştirilebilir. Gerçek anlamda, yazılımın kullanıcıya sunduğu varlık ve hak, yatırımcıların buna ödemek istediği fiyatı tanımlar yani varlığın değerini belirler.
Soft Fork (Geçici Çatallaşma)
Nedir?
Eğer yazılım (blok zinciri) üzerinde yapılan değişiklik önceki bloklarla uyumluysa buna soft fork denir.
Nasıl olur?
Blok zinciri üzerinde bulunan mutabakat halindeki düğümlerin [node(makine)] teorik olarak en az %50+1’i bu değişikliği oylayıp kabul ederse değişiklik geçerli olur. Blok ve mutabakat yazısında anlattığım gibi eğer fikir birliği olursa dağıtılmış defterler güncellenir. Blok Zinciri de yapısı itibarıyla en uzun zinciri onaylama eğilimde olduğundan dolayı en fazla oylanmış bloklar geçerli olur. Böylece zincir üzerindeki blok yapısı değiştirilmiş olur.
İstenilen olmazsa?
Eğer soft fork düşük hash gücüyle destekleniyorsa yani blok zincirindeki node’ların destek oranı düşükse, her ne kadar teorik olarak %50+1 gerekiyorsa da bu zaman içinde değişebileceğinden dolayı daha yüksek oranda destek beklenir, eğer destek düşük kalırsa oluşacak yeni çatal âtıl durumda kalabilir. Örneğin, yaz mevsimi içerisinde gerçekleşen Bitcoin segwit soft fork’u için beklenen destek oranı %80 idi ve bu oran yakalandığında soft fork’a gidildi.
Had Fork (Zorunlu Çatallaşma)
Nedir?
Eğer yazılım (blok zinciri) üzerinde yapılan değişiklik önceki bloklarla uyumlu değilse yani bir bakıma kullanıcının varlık üzerindeki haklarını değiştiriyorsa buna hard fork denir.
Nasıl olur?
Yazılımın eski sürümünü çalıştırmaya devam eden düğümler yeni işlemlerin geçersiz olduğunu görecektir. Dolayısıyla, yeni zincire geçmek ve geçerli blokları aramaya devam etmek için, ağdaki tüm düğümlerin yeni kurallara yükseltilmesi gerekir. Eğer düğümler yükseltilmezse eski blok yapısına göre blok zinciri içerisinde kalır. Yükseltirse yeni oluşan blok zincirine dahil olur ki bu da çoğu zaman yeni bir kripto-para demektir.
Yanlış giden ne?
Aslında bu durum, tam bir politik çıkmaz örneğidir. Siyasette olan kendi partisinde değişiklik yapma gücü bulamayan politikacıların yeni bir siyasi parti kurmasına benzer. Bu çatallaşma için soft forkta olduğu gibi herhangi bir destek gerekmez. Geliştiriciler kendi çatallarını oluşturabilir.
Bunun en güzel iki örneği, Ethereum ve Bitcoin hard forkudur. Ethereum forku sonucunda Ethereum ve Ethereum Classic olarak iki coin, Bitcoin forku sonucunda Bitcoin Cash ortaya çıkmıştır.
User-Activated Soft Fork (Kullanıcı Aktivasyonlu Geçici Çatallaşma)
Nedir?
Bir kullanıcı tarafından herhangi bir oy almayı beklemeden yazılım üzerinde değişiklik gerçekleştirmesi fikrine UASF (Kullanıcı Aktivasyonlu Geçici Çatallaşma) denir.
Fikre göre, düğümlerden gelecek desteği beklemek yerine, borsa ve cüzdan desteğini alıp soft forka gidilebilir.
Nasıl olur?
Bazı borsaların yazılımdaki değişiklikleri kendi sistemine eklenir. Daha sonra yeni yazılım soft forka katılmak istenen düğümlere eklenir.
Ne yanlış gidebilir?
Bu yöntem, normal soft forka göre daha uzun zaman gerektirir. Ayrıca madenciler coinin değer düşmesini durdurmak için de bu bu soft foku desteklemek isteyebilirler. Burada en önemli etkenin fiyat olabileceği düşünülüyor.
Şuan olarak bu fikir teori aşamasındadır ve uygulanmaMAktadır.
—————————————————————
Yıl içerisinde bizi bazı önemli çatallaşmalar bekliyor. Bunların en yakını 25 Ekimde lansmanı yapılacak olan Bitcoin Gold. Bu konu hakkındaki görüşlerimi ve analizlerimi de akşam saatlerinde yollayacağım bültende okuyabileceksiniz. Düşüncelerim size biraz komplo teorisi gibi gelebilir, fakat bunlar sistemin mümkün kıldığı şeyler olduğunu görünce şaşıracaksınız sanıyorum. :)
Şimdilik Hoşça Kalın.
Hakan.
Beğenip paylaşmayı unutmayın.
Bu konuyu sevdin mi? Evet Hayır
Hakan'ın Blockchain & Bitcoin & Altcoin Yazıları
Hakan'ın Blockchain & Bitcoin & Altcoin Yazıları

Blok Zinciri

Abonelikten çıkmak için buraya tıkla.
Bu bülteni yönlendirirseniz ve beğenirseniz, abone olabilirsiniz: buraya.
Created with Revue by Twitter.